San Diego County Pollutant Multi-Year Trends
PM2.5 annual mean (NAAQS 9 µg/m³ (annual))Health riskFine inhalable particles 2.5 micrometers or smaller. They travel deep into the lungs and into the bloodstream — linked to asthma, heart disease, stroke, and premature death.
PM2.5 annual mean (NAAQS 9 µg/m³ (annual)) concentrations have fallen 39% since 2010.
PM2.5 24-hour 98th percentile (NAAQS 35 µg/m³ (24-hour))Health riskFine inhalable particles 2.5 micrometers or smaller. They travel deep into the lungs and into the bloodstream — linked to asthma, heart disease, stroke, and premature death.
PM2.5 24-hour 98th percentile (NAAQS 35 µg/m³ (24-hour)) concentrations have more than halved since 2010.
Ozone 8-hour 4th-highest daily max (NAAQS 0.070 ppm (8-hour))Health riskGround-level ozone (smog) forms when vehicle and industrial emissions react in sunlight. Inflames the airways, triggers asthma attacks, and worsens heart and lung disease.
Ozone 8-hour 4th-highest daily max (NAAQS 0.070 ppm (8-hour)) concentrations are roughly unchanged from 2010.
NO₂ annual mean (NAAQS 53 ppb (annual))Health riskA tailpipe and combustion gas. Concentrates near busy roads and industrial sites; raises risk of airway inflammation, asthma, and lower respiratory infections in children.
NO₂ annual mean (NAAQS 53 ppb (annual)) concentrations have more than halved since 2010.

Where The Chemical Releases Are Concentrated
| Facility | City | Top chemical | Total releases | YoY |
|---|---|---|---|---|
| US Marine Corps Mcb Camp PendletonUS Department Of Defense | Camp Pendleton | Lead And Lead CompoundsHealth riskNeurotoxin. Even low childhood exposure impairs cognitive development; chronic adult exposure damages kidneys and the cardiovascular system. (EPA, ATSDR) | 415k lb | -26% |
| General Dynamics (Nassco)General Dynamics CORP | San Diego | Xylene (mixed isomers)Health riskEye, skin, and respiratory irritant; central-nervous-system effects from chronic exposure. (EPA) | 128k lb | -19% |
| Gkn Aerospace Chem-Tronics INCGkn Aerospace US Holdings LLC (Delaware Llc) | El Cajon | Nitrate compounds (water dissociable; reportable only when in aqueous solution)Health riskDrinking-water nitrate causes methemoglobinemia ('blue-baby syndrome') in infants; EPA MCL is 10 mg/L as N. (EPA) | 56k lb | +11% |
| U.S. Naval Air Station North IslandUS Department Of Defense | San Diego | Methyl isobutyl ketoneHealth riskEye, skin, and respiratory irritant; central-nervous-system depressant at high exposure. (NIOSH) | 38k lb | -10% |
| Polypeptide Laboratories San DiegoPolypeptide Laboratories INC | San Diego | N,N-DimethylformamideHealth riskHepatotoxin; absorbed through skin; IARC Group 2A probable carcinogen. (IARC) | 30k lb | +9689% |
| Bae Systems San Diego Ship RepairBae Systems INC | San Diego | Aluminum oxide (fibrous forms)Health riskFibrous forms can damage the lungs similar to other particulate dusts. (NIOSH) | 30k lb | -92% |
| Honeywell Industrial SafetyHoneywell International INC | San Diego | Toluene diisocyanate (mixed isomers)Health riskSevere respiratory sensitizer; leading cause of occupational asthma; IARC Group 2B. (IARC, OSHA) | 26k lb | — |
| US Marine Corps Air Station MiramarUS Department Of Defense | San Diego | LeadHealth riskNeurotoxin. Even low childhood exposure impairs cognitive development; chronic adult exposure damages kidneys and the cardiovascular system. (EPA, ATSDR) | 25k lb | +8% |
| US Navy Silver Strand Training Complex (Sstc)US Department Of Defense | Coronado | Lead And Lead CompoundsHealth riskNeurotoxin. Even low childhood exposure impairs cognitive development; chronic adult exposure damages kidneys and the cardiovascular system. (EPA, ATSDR) | 21k lb | -14% |
| Integrated Dna TechnologiesDanaher CORP | San Diego | AcetonitrileHealth riskMetabolizes to cyanide in the body; high exposure causes nausea, weakness, and respiratory effects. (ATSDR) | 11k lb | +41% |
